Designing one memorable creature voice is already a creative challenge. Roco Kingdom: World required a system for more than 500 collectible creatures, known as Jinglings.
Each Jingling needed its own personality, emotional range, physical presence, actions, combat sounds, and evolutionary identity. Together, the work represented more than 50,000 bespoke sounds, created without relying on template-driven identities or generic movement libraries.
The challenge was not only scale. It was preserving individuality while building a coherent sonic language that could continue expanding with the game.

THE CHALLENGE
Every Jingling needed to feel distinctive on its own while still belonging to a wider family, ecosystem, and world.
Related creatures had to remain recognizable without sounding interchangeable. Evolutionary forms needed to become older, larger, more powerful, or more unusual while preserving the identity of the original creature. New regions and future content also required a repeatable design logic that could expand without collapsing into repetition.
The result needed to feel like a living creature ecosystem rather than a collection of disconnected sound assets.
IDENTITY BEFORE SCALE
MoreFun Studio and POSTRED began by studying each Jingling’s artwork, animation, biological references, elemental qualities, and personality.
Before committing to full production, the teams created small identity-defining demos built around a few emotional states. These early prototypes allowed the creative leads to evaluate personality, vocal palette, and emotional readability before investing in the complete set of voices, actions, combat sounds, and variations.
This established a central production principle:
Lock in the creature’s sonic identity before scaling.
The same principle guided differentiation. Related creatures shared enough biological or stylistic language to feel connected, while articulation, pitch, rhythm, texture, and emotional energy gave each one its own identity. Across evolutionary forms, recognizable traits were preserved while the voice developed in scale, age, confidence, or power.

ORIGINAL PERFORMANCE AND SOUND DESIGN
Original performance remained central to the project.
The teams combined experimental vocal performance, animal recordings, Foley, musical instruments, custom-built sources, synthesis, and sound-design processing.
POSTRED’s Foley stages were used to record custom movement, impacts, traversal, body detail, and character actions. Vocal performers provided emotional precision that animals could not be expected to perform on command, while animal recordings gave the voices biological credibility. Musical and synthetic elements helped define Jinglings whose magical anatomy had no direct real-world equivalent.
The objective was not to create the densest possible sound. It was to build a focused palette that felt expressive, believable, and connected to the animation.

A COMPREHENSIVE SOUNDSCAPE
Voices and actions formed the foundation, but the wider design extended into riding, singing, ecological behavior, and music.
Riding sounds reflected each Jingling’s size, speed, gait, body structure, and manner of movement. These sounds required dedicated treatment because they are heard continuously during traversal and directly affect how the mount feels to the player.
Singing extended creature voices into musical behavior. Selected Jinglings could perform alone or together, while ecological systems allowed creatures to react, communicate, and behave beyond direct player interaction.
The MoreFun Studio audio team carried these identities into broader gameplay systems, including personality-related voice triggers, pitch variation, behavior states, ecological interactions, and Jingling-based music.
Together, these layers created a comprehensive soundscape around each creature.

COLLABORATION AT SCALE
MoreFun Studio and POSTRED worked as closely connected creative and production teams.
MoreFun established the wider audio vision, gameplay requirements, implementation systems, and final in-game integration. POSTRED contributed creature voice and action sound design, original recording, Foley, editing, experimentation, asset production, and scalable production support.
Shared briefs, identity-defining demos, clear feedback, and early iteration reduced the risk of large-scale rework. Once a creature’s identity was approved, the teams could move confidently into full production.
This collaborative model allowed structure and experimentation to coexist. The process remained scalable without reducing the Jinglings to templates.
THE RESULT
The collaboration produced a repeatable creature-audio pipeline supporting more than 500 Jinglings and over 50,000 bespoke sounds.
More importantly, scale did not erase character.
Jinglings communicate personality, emotion, physicality, and identity through sound. Related species remain distinct. Evolutions develop without losing their origins. Mounts differ in weight and movement. Singing and ecological behaviors make the world feel active beyond combat and direct player interaction.
The scalable foundation did more than save production time. It allowed the teams to invest that time in the details, interactions, and creative systems that make the Jinglings feel alive.
